BayFM Community Radio is a volunteer run, not for profit radio station committed to keeping the community informed on local and global issues, presenting music and information not available on other media in this area, and on creating and maintaining a positive spirit in the community.

How to listen to Bay FM online for free

Audio streams

You can click button to try to listen to this radio station using our web player.
Sometimes it won't work because audio type could be not supported by your browser. In this case, you can try to use these direct links to the streams:
Also, some stations have licensing restrictions for different countries, so they could block listeners from specific countries.
play
6%
85%
6 minutes ago: Def Leppard - Too Late For Love
play
5%
83%
a minute ago: Billy Joel - Piano Man
play
3%
86%
8 minutes ago: TALLA 2XLC - 1998
play watch
13%
99%
a minute ago: Christie - Yellow River (1970)
play
3%
95%
9 minutes ago: Djo - End Of Beginning
play watch
31%
69%
5 minutes ago: Fun - We Are Young
play watch
26%
52%
9 minutes ago: MEGA 97.9 - LA #1 - MEGA 97.9 - LA #1 EN VIVO JUNGLA DE ACERO SW2 20600
play watch
10%
99%
a few seconds ago: Gorillaz,Anoushka Shankar,Bizarrap,Kara Jackson - Orange county
play watch
11%
95%
3 minutes ago: Patti Austin - If I Believed
play watch
13%
76%
3 minutes ago: RIHANNA FT. MIKKY EKKO - STAY
play watch
47%
89%
9 minutes ago: Richard Elliot - When a Man Loves a Woman
play watch
33%
87%
8 minutes ago: Sly & The Family Stone - Hot Fun In The Summertime
play watch
32%
97%
2 minutes ago: Barry Manilow - One Voice
play watch
33%
51%
4 minutes ago: The Weeknd - The Hills
play watch
29%
94%
7 minutes ago: Meghan Trainor - Get In Girl